Nancy Mace, the South Carolina Republican congresswoman, unleashed a tirade towards regulation enforcement on the Charleston Worldwide Airport on Thursday, WIRED has realized.
In accordance with an incident report obtained by WIRED beneath South Carolina’s Freedom of Data Act, Mace cursed at cops, making repeated derogatory feedback towards them. The report says {that a} Transportation Safety Administration (TSA) supervisor advised officers that Mace had handled their workers equally, and that they’d be reporting her to their superiors.
In accordance with the report, officers with the Charleston County Aviation Authority Police Division have been tasked with assembly Mace at 6:30 am to escort her from the curb to her flight, and had been advised that she can be arriving in a white BMW on the ticketing curb space. Round 6:35, the report says, they have been advised she was working late; they by no means noticed the automobile arrive.
Shortly earlier than 7:00am, the report said, dispatch advised the officers that Mace was on the entrance for the Identified Crewmember program (KCM)—a trusted entry lane with a smaller checkpoint overseen by the TSA and meant for flight crew members.
When officers shortly situated her, in keeping with a supplemental incident report filed by one of many officers, the congresswoman instantly started “loudly cursing and making derogatory feedback to us in regards to the division. She repeatedly said we have been ‘Fucking incompetent,’ and ‘that is no method to deal with a fucking US Consultant,’” the report states.
As officers escorted her to her gate, in keeping with the report, she introduced a South Carolina Senate colleague into the fracas.
“She additionally stated we’d by no means deal with Tim Scott like this,” says one officer tasked with escorting Mace says within the report.
“The complete stroll to gate B-8 she was cursing and complaining and sometimes doing the identical into her telephone,” an officer writes within the report. In the principle incident report, an officer notes that Mace was yelling into her telephone, both on a telephone name or dictating textual content messages. “After standing within the neighborhood of B-8 for a number of minutes along with her persevering with her tirade, she lastly boarded the plane.”
After Mace’s flight took off, the report states, an American Airways gate agent approached the officers. In accordance with the report, he “said he was in disbelief concerning her conduct. He implied {that a} US Consultant shouldn’t be performing the best way she was.”
The report goes on to state that officers checked with a TSA supervisor, who advised the officers “he was very upset with how she acted on the checkpoint.” This supervisor, in keeping with the report, advised the officers that Mace had “talked to a number of TSA brokers the identical method” and that they’d be “submitting a report back to his superiors about her unacceptable conduct.” TSA brokers will not be at present being totally paid, because of the ongoing authorities shutdown.
